CRYSTAL STRUCTURE OF NIOBIUM DIOXIDE (in French)

The x-ray-diffraction results on NbO/sub 2/, prepared by heating in vacuo a mixture of powders of Nb/sub 2/O/sub 6/ and Nb, confirm the previous electron-diffraction results obtained with thin films. Besides the strong reflections attributed to a rutile lattice structure, a great number of additional weak reflections were observed. Following this observation, the structure analysis was undertaken by calculating the structure factors on various models. Three types of possible structures derived from the rutile structure were investigated; a superlattice, a defective lattice, and an interstitial lattice structure, respectively. It is concluded that there is only one possible structure modification of a superlattice type. Some of the O-Nb-O molecules in the rutile structure change their molecular orientation on the (001) planes whose stacking sequence is expressed by alpha BETA alpha ' BETA alpha ... (auth)
